    Matthew Mayes

    Co-founder & CSO at Sway

    Matthew Mayes is a dedicated sustainability advocate and expert, committed to creating innovative solutions for a more sustainable future. With a profound understanding of environmental issues, he is currently leading the charge at Sway Co., where he serves as the Co-founder and Chief Sustainability Officer. Matthew is focused on investigating practical alternatives to single-use plastics through his initiative at Sway, reflecting his commitment to environmental sustainability, resource conservation, and advancing clean energy solutions.

    A proud alumnus of the University of California, Berkeley, Matthew holds a Master of Development Practice in Sustainable Development, as well as a Bachelor of Arts in Political Economy. His educational background laid a solid foundation for his career in sustainability and his multifaceted approach to tackling global challenges related to economic and environmental sustainability.

    Throughout his professional journey, Matthew has built a rich portfolio of experience. He worked as an Environmental Strategy Consultant at DocuSign, where he integrated sustainability practices into corporate strategies. His role as a Graduate Student Instructor at UC Berkeley not only showcased his expertise in sustainable development but also his passion for education and mentorship. Additionally, he served as a Consultant Team Lead at Principle Power, emphasizing the importance of innovative solutions in the renewable energy sector.

    One of Matthew's key accomplishments includes being a USAID Global Development Fellow at su-re.co, where he engaged in critical projects aimed at enhancing sustainability and resilience in various communities. His roles at Berkeley Lab as a Business Development Consultant demonstrate his strong skills in fostering collaborative opportunities aimed at advancing scientific research and sustainable practices. In past endeavors, Matthew also made significant contributions as a Research & Market Development Consultant at Fair Trade USA and as a Corporate Client Services Associate at UniversalGiving, where his focus on social responsibility and ethical business practices helped elevate the importance of sustainability in corporate frameworks.
